MORELAND COMMUNITY HISTORICAL SOCIETY, founded in 2013, is a micro nonprofit in the Arts, Culture & Humanities sector that reported $34K in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ue fell 34% from the prior year — a significant decline worth monitoring. Expenses of $33K left a modest 3% surplus.

Mission

TO COLLECT AND PRESERVE HISTORICAL MATERIALS RELATED TO MORELAND AND FRANKLIN TOWNSHIP, WAYNE COUNTY, OHIO AND TO EDUCATE THE PUBLIC ABOUT THE PAST.
